Synthesis of 5-Methanesulfonamido-6-(2,4-Difluorophenylthio)-1-Indanone
作者:John Scheigetz、Robert Zamboni、Bruno Roy
DOI:10.1080/00397919508011826
日期:1995.9
The ethylene ketal of 5-nitro-6-bromo-1-indanone 6 was prepared via oxidation of N-(6-Bromo-5-indanyl)-acetamide 1. A subsequent mild displace; merit and elaboration to 6-thiosubstituted-5amino indanone derivative 10 is also described.
